Why Stupid Love makes so much sense as a lead single

I absolutely adore Stupid Love, and I think it is an absolute banger, and it can be played anywhere and everywhere, from radio stations to clubs to shopping malls to clothing stores to restaurants, urgh it's just so UNIVERSAL. I love everything she did in the past, but let's be honest, lyrics like 'high like amphetamine' and 'One second I'm a koons and suddenly the koons is me' aren't exactly digestible for the ordinary audience. Now I know what you're thinking:

But Bradley, since when do we condone Gaga catering to mainstream audiences? This is Lady Gaga!

#1 Lady Gaga, is a pop artist, and she still needs to perform well commercially, she answers to an entire team of people who depend on her for their wages. Interscope also plays a role in choosing the most commercially profitable song. It's like how they picked Applause over Aura.

#2 This is why it makes so much sense to have something 'less intelligent' to be the lead.

If you've noticed how recent artists with great albums, Taylor Swift with Lover, Selena Gomez with Rare, Madonna with Madame X, started with mediocre lead singles? Fans have expressed their lack of satisfaction with the leads (Me!, Look at Her Now/Lose You to Love Me, Medellin/Crave/Future), but end up praising the albums to the heavens? This sentiment is also echoed by the critics, who all gave their leads mixed reviews but very positively reviewed their albums.

Compare this to Katy Perry who started strong with Chained to the Rhythm, promising a political 'woke' era, and then Witness ending up being disastrous.

With Stupid Love, Gaga is able to tone down the expectations for LG6, not because she can't deliver, but because it is a smarter strategy to play with the critics' and our psychology. We all remember how she promised ARTPOP to be the album of the millennium, promising how it was gonna revolutionise the chemistry between ART and POP, and critics ended up asking 'where is the art in this pop album?' Stupid Love does exactly the opposite, it promises nothing. It's meant to be a mega-hit that everyone eats up, meant to be escapism, meant to be played everywhere, have everyone dancing, have everyone be reminded of 'Lady Gaga' as the pop queen we once knew. It is a great transition from Joanne and A Star Is Born, before the real thing comes. Once she has established her comeback without actually heightening our expectations too much, she can easily secure more positive reviews for her album. Lover succeeeded in that, Rare did, even Anti did.

Work was panned by so many pop fans for its ludicrous lyrics, and Anti ended up being a fcking masterpiece? Work also got nominated for Record of the Year and Best Rap/Sung, if i'm not mistaken.

LG6 has come, but it hasn't arrived yet. Once this is over, Gaga'll be like "Okay now we've had fun, now that I've gotten the world's attention, are we ready for the things that the radios and the GP don't feel comfortable playing?"
